-// To use this class, create an instance with the desired URL and a pointer to |
-// the object to be notified when the URL has been loaded: |
-// URLFetcher* fetcher = new URLFetcher("http://www.google.com", |
-// URLFetcher::GET, this); |
-// |
-// Then, optionally set properties on this object, like the request context or |
-// extra headers: |
-// fetcher->set_extra_request_headers("X-Foo: bar"); |
-// |
-// Finally, start the request: |
-// fetcher->Start(); |
-// |
-// |
-// The object you supply as a delegate must inherit from |
-// content::URLFetcherDelegate; when the fetch is completed, |
-// OnURLFetchComplete() will be called with a pointer to the URLFetcher. From |
-// that point until the original URLFetcher instance is destroyed, you may use |
-// accessor methods to see the result of the fetch. You should copy these |
-// objects if you need them to live longer than the URLFetcher instance. If the |
-// URLFetcher instance is destroyed before the callback happens, the fetch will |
-// be canceled and no callback will occur. |
-// |
-// You may create the URLFetcher instance on any thread; OnURLFetchComplete() |
-// will be called back on the same thread you use to create the instance. |
-// |
-// |
-// NOTE: By default URLFetcher requests are NOT intercepted, except when |
-// interception is explicitly enabled in tests. |
